P. SPECHT. The 1867 Dubuque City Directory gave no address for this business although it was listed as a crockery/glassware retailer.The 1870-1871 Dubuque City Directory stated that this business was located on the northeast corner of Eagle Point Avenue and Couler.

The 1874-1875 Dubuque City Directory gave the address of this business as 2180 Couler Avenue.

According to the 1883 Dubuque City Directory, this business, a tavern, was located at 2184 Couler Avenue.
